From this question, the revolutionary concept of Keurig K-CupĀ® portion pack brewing was born.

Keurig was founded by coffee lovers who believed that coffee should always be served fresh, whether at home or at the office, just as in a gourmet coffee house. They noticed that people were constantly leaving their homes and offices in search of a fresh cup of coffee and asked themselves:
Today, Keurig, Incorporated is the leader in single-cup coffee brewing technology in the U.S. for both home and office. Introduced in 1998, Keurig’s innovative single-cup brewing system lets coffee lovers brew perfect coffee, one cup at a time, in less than a minute.

Keurig’s patented single-cup brewing system lets people brew a perfect cup of gourmet coffee in less than a minute without the hassle of grinding beans, measuring coffee, handling filters or cleaning up. Keurig takes away all the guesswork from brewing a consistently great cup of coffee.
